CDC prototype cosmics data

  • 50/50 mixed Ar, CO2
  • Recalibrated MFCs
  • Outer plenum added to CDC prototype to prevent leaks
  • New pre-production HVB
  • 2100V
  • Modified preamp4 (terminating resistors removed)
  • Prototype tilted at 30o to enclosing scintillators (scints trigger the daq)
  • New timing setup (recording coinc logic signal)

Drift times run 31724 (30o to horizontal, 2100V) where drift time (ns) is cdc time - trigger time + 100 and cdc time is the time extracted from the cdc signal x 8ns.
Ch23 cdc time - trigger time hit thr 5sigma timing thr 1sigma, bump intervals 11, 25, 24, 28, 22, 26 (mean 22.7, 25.0 excluding 11)
Ch20 cdc time - trigger time hit thr 5sigma timing thr 1sigma, bump intervals 29, 21, 31, 24, 29, 30 (mean 27.3)
Ch20 cdc time hit thr 5sigma timing thr 1sigma, bump intervals 25, 24, 28, 19 (mean 24.0)

Drift times run 31757 (horizontal, 2100V)

Ch23 cdc time - trigger time hit thr 5sigma timing thr 1sigma, bump intervals 30, 23, 26, 25, 30 (mean 26.8)
Ch20 cdc time - trigger time hit thr 5sigma timing thr 1sigma, bump intervals 24, 21, 26, 26 (mean 24.3)
Ch20 cdc time hit thr 5sigma timing thr 1sigma, bump intervals 15, 11, 20, 14, 17 (mean 15.4)
Drift times run 31761 (25o to horizontal, 2100V) where drift time (ns) is cdc time - trigger time + 100 and cdc time is the time extracted from the cdc signal x 8ns. Before this run I disabled the 125MHz clock circuit feeding the (unused) Struck fADCs.
Ch23 cdc time - trigger time hit thr 5sigma timing thr 1sigma, bump intervals 15, 30, 21 (mean 25.5)
Ch20 cdc time - trigger time hit thr 5sigma timing thr 1sigma, bump intervals 47,45 (mean 46)
Ch20 cdc time hit thr 5sigma timing thr 1sigma, bump intervals 22, 28, 21, 24 (mean 24.0)
Drift times run 31744 (horizontal, 2300V, 40%Ar 60%CO2) where drift time (ns) is cdc time - trigger time + 100 and cdc time is the time extracted from the cdc signal x 8ns.
Ch20 cdc time hit thr 5sigma timing thr 1sigma, bump intervals 21,31,35


Drift times run 31746 (horizontal, rolled over onto one edge, 2300V, 40%Ar 60%CO2) where drift time (ns) is cdc time - trigger time + 100 and cdc time is the time extracted from the cdc signal x 8ns.
Ch20 cdc time hit thr 5sigma timing thr 1sigma, bump intervals 20,29

Bump at 117ns after t0 for 40/60 gas corresponds to approx 3.3mm from wire, same time for 50/50 corresponds to ~3.5mm from wire. A hit 3.5mm from the wire in 40/60 gas would be at 130ns, moving to 118ns for 50/50.
